diff --git a/arch/x86/include/asm/fpu/sched.h b/arch/x86/include/asm/fpu/sched.h new file mode 100644 index 000000000000..89004f4ca208 --- /dev/null +++ b/arch/x86/include/asm/fpu/sched.h @@ -0,0 +1,55 @@ +/* S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0 */ +#ifndef _ASM_X86_FPU_SCHED_H +#define _ASM_X86_FPU_SCHED_H + +#include <linux/sched.h> + +#include <asm/cpufeature.h> +#include <asm/fpu/types.h> + +#include <asm/trace/fpu.h> + +extern void save_fpregs_to_fpstate(struct fpu *fpu); +extern void fpu__drop(struct task_struct *tsk); +extern int fpu_clone(struct task_struct *dst, u64 clone_flags, bool minimal, + unsigned long shstk_addr); +extern void fpu_flush_thread(void); + +/* + * FPU state switching for scheduling. + * + * switch_fpu() saves the old state and sets TIF_NEED_FPU_LOAD if + * TIF_NEED_FPU_LOAD is not set. This is done within the context + * of the old process. + * + * Once TIF_NEED_FPU_LOAD is set, it is required to load the + * registers before returning to userland or using the content + * otherwise. + * + * The FPU context is only stored/restored for a user task and + * PF_KTHREAD is used to distinguish between kernel and user threads. + */ +static inline void switch_fpu(struct task_struct *old, int cpu) +{ + if (!test_tsk_thread_flag(old, TIF_NEED_FPU_LOAD) && + cpu_feature_enabled(X86_FEATURE_FPU) && + !(old->flags & (PF_KTHREAD | PF_USER_WORKER))) { + struct fpu *old_fpu = x86_task_fpu(old); + + set_tsk_thread_flag(old, TIF_NEED_FPU_LOAD); + save_fpregs_to_fpstate(old_fpu); + /* + * The save operation preserved register state, so the + * fpu_fpregs_owner_ctx is still @old_fpu. Store the + * current CPU number in @old_fpu, so the next return + * to user space can avoid the FPU register restore + * when is returns on the same CPU and still owns the + * context. See fpregs_restore_userregs(). + */ + old_fpu->last_cpu = cpu; + + trace_x86_fpu_regs_deactivated(old_fpu); + } +} + +#endif /* _ASM_X86_FPU_SCHED_H */ |
